To confirm this result, we also performed a one‐way ANOVA for the imitation stage and found a significant word effect over the right aIPS ( F 3,54 = 3.402, p < .05), left aIPS ( F 3,54 = 3.272, p < .05), right vPM ( F 3,54 = 5.663, p < .01), left vPM ( F 3,54 = 5.230, p < .01), and left STS ( F 3,54 = 8.095, p < .001), and a nearly significant effect over the right STS ( F 3,54 = 2.443, p = .074).
